What is Hd_util.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by more than one program at the same time. It’s like a library of functions and resources that other programs can use. The hd_util.dll file specifically is a part of the software HotDocs Player 11 and it contains important functions that are used by the HotDocs Player program.

When HotDocs Player 11 is running on a computer, it needs to access the functions and resources in the hd_util.dll file to perform certain tasks. The file hd_util.dll is really important for HotDocs Player 11 to work properly because it contains code and resources that the program needs to function. Without hd_util.dll, HotDocs Player 11 might not be able to perform certain tasks or it might not work at all.

So, this file is crucial for the proper functioning of the HotDocs Player 11 software.

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:

  • Cannot register hd_util.dll: The message means that the operating system failed to register the DLL file. This can happen if there are file permission issues, if the DLL file is missing or misplaced, or if there's an issue with the Registry.
  • The file hd_util.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
  • Hd_util.dll Access Violation: This indicates a process tried to access or modify a memory location related to hd_util.dll that it isn't allowed to. This is often a sign of problems with the software using the DLL, such as bugs or corruption.
  • Hd_util.dll not found: The required DLL file is absent from the expected directory. This can result from software uninstalls, updates, or system changes that mistakenly remove or relocate DLL files.
  • Hd_util.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.

Perform a Clean Boot

Perform a Clean Boot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
13
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
7
Description

How to perform a clean boot. This can isolate the issue with hd_util.dll and help resolve the problem.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the hd_util.dll problem persists.
